    Singer Pallaso has branded the late Mowzey Radio as one of the biggest gangsters despite his soft look that he always portrayed.

    Pallaso has occasionally been involved in disputes with fellow artists, including Alien Skin and King Saha. During one of his live TikTok broadcasts, Pallaso addressed critics labeling him a gangster, claiming that the late Mowzey Radio was worse than him.

    While the public was used to seeing Radio Mowzey’s soft side, especially when he released his love songs, Pallaso revealed that behind that display was a person who harbored a soldier-like heart.

    Pallaso narrated the first time he experienced a different side of Radio years back. He narrated that he had entered Sherry’s Cafe, and when he stepped out, he witnessed one of the biggest fights, and it was Radio against random boda boda riders.

    One of the men allegedly kicked Radio in the chest, and he fell flat on the ground, but he immediately got up and started fighting again. He jumped into Chagga’s car, and they ran away, but the boda guys got to them and ended up burning Chagga’s car.

    “You might see me as a gangster, but you do not know that Radio Mowzey was the biggest gangster. His heart was for soldiers even when he used to sign soft love songs. After that incident, in my heart, I felt he was too fearless because he could have easily died at that spot. That was my first time witnessing Radio fighting,” he said.

    Radio passed away at Case Clinic in 2018 following severe head injuries sustained in a bar fight in Entebbe.
